(Quick) Pickled Red Onions

  • 1 large red onion, very thinly sliced
  • 1/2 cup warm water
  • 1/2 cup apple cider vinegar
  • 2 teaspoons fine sea salt
  1. Thinly slice onions and pack them into a 1-pint mason jar.
  2. Pour the remaining ingredients over the sliced onions. Seal the mason jar and shake vigorously for 10-15 seconds.
  3. Place the sealed jar in the refrigerator for a minimum of 2-3 hours to allow the flavors to marinate and the onions to soften.
  4. These make a great topping for salads, sandwiches, and wraps!
